Alt-Lending

SMEs Begin To Test The Regulation A+ Waters
 

Regulation A+ under the JOBS Act, which went into effect in 2015, allows SMEs to raise equity via the average Joe. GrowthFountain launched this month as one of the first platforms to link those Joes and small businesses in need of financing. CEO Ken Staut gives PYMNTS a history lesson on the regulation that makes equity crowdfunding possible, and explains why it may have a leg-up on the largely unregulated alt-lending space.
